如何注释java
单行注释
在Java中,单行注释以双斜杠 // 开头,仅对当前行有效。适用于简短说明或临时禁用代码。
// 这是一个单行注释
int x = 10; // 声明并初始化变量x
多行注释
多行注释以 /* 开头,以 */ 结尾,可跨越多行。常用于方法或复杂逻辑的详细说明。
/*
* 这是一个多行注释示例
* 可以包含多行文本
*/
int y = 20;
文档注释
文档注释以 / 开头,以 */ 结尾,用于生成API文档(通过javadoc工具)。通常包含类、方法或字段的详细描述及标签(如@param、@return)。

/
* 计算两数之和
* @param a 第一个加数
* @param b 第二个加数
* @return 两数之和
*/
public int add(int a, int b) {
return a + b;
}
注释的最佳实践
- 清晰简洁:注释应解释“为什么”而非“做什么”(代码本身应直观)。
- 避免冗余:如
int count = 0; // 初始化count为0是多余的。 - 及时更新:修改代码时同步更新注释,避免误导。
特殊用途注释
- TODO标记:标识待完成的任务。
// TODO: 优化算法效率 - 临时禁用代码:用注释暂时屏蔽代码块。
// System.out.println("调试信息");
通过合理使用注释,可显著提升代码的可维护性和协作效率。






